Casey Posted March 14, 2022 Posted March 14, 2022 Is there anything in kit form which is very close to the factory full wheel cover for a 1970 Ford Galaxie (not LTD), as pictured below?
ChrisBcritter Posted March 15, 2022 Posted March 15, 2022 (edited) I have an idea, but it's a bit involved (four pieces) - best for a casting master. You'd need: 1 wheelcover from the AMT Avanti 2 wheelcovers from the Lindberg/AMT '64 Belvedere 1 wheelcover from the AMT '69 Ford LTD Cut out the Avanti wheelcover like the one on the right: Take the center from one '64 Plymouth wheelcover and countersink it into the second so it's level with the cone: Cut down the combined Plymouth wheel until it fits into the Avanti rim. Lastly, cut the center emblem from a '69 Ford Galaxie and glue it to the center of the new cover. Quick-and-dirty version: Use the Plymouth wheelcovers as is and add the five slots with a fine black art pen, like a normal person would do. Edited March 15, 2022 by ChrisBcritter
